Binance Smart Chain vs Solana: A Comprehensive Comparison

In the rapidly evolving world of blockchain technology, two prominent platforms have emerged as leading contenders: Binance Smart Chain (BSC) and Solana. Both platforms offer unique features and capabilities, making them attractive choices for developers and users alike. In this article, we will delve into a comprehensive comparison of Binance Smart Chain and Solana, highlighting their key differences and strengths.
1. Overview of Binance Smart Chain
Binance Smart Chain is a decentralized blockchain platform that was launched by Binance, one of the world's largest cryptocurrency exchanges. It was designed to provide a scalable, secure, and efficient platform for decentralized applications (dApps) and smart contracts. BSC aims to address the limitations of traditional blockchains, such as Ethereum, by offering faster transaction speeds and lower fees.
1.1 Key Features of Binance Smart Chain
- High Scalability: BSC utilizes a unique dual-token mechanism, BNB and BSC, to achieve high scalability. This mechanism allows for a high throughput of transactions per second, making it suitable for applications with high user demand.
- Low Fees: With its efficient consensus mechanism, BSC offers significantly lower transaction fees compared to Ethereum. This makes it an attractive option for developers looking to create cost-effective dApps.
- Cross-Chain Compatibility: BSC supports cross-chain interoperability, allowing users to transfer assets and data between different blockchains, including Ethereum.
- Smart Contracts: BSC supports smart contracts, enabling developers to build decentralized applications with ease.
2. Overview of Solana
Solana is a high-performance blockchain platform designed to handle a massive number of transactions per second. It was created by Anatoly Yakovenko, a former engineer at Qualcomm. Solana aims to address the scalability issues faced by traditional blockchains by implementing a unique consensus mechanism called Proof of History (PoH).
2.1 Key Features of Solana
- High Throughput: Solana can handle up to 50,000 transactions per second, making it one of the fastest blockchain platforms available.
- Low Fees: With its efficient consensus mechanism, Solana offers extremely low transaction fees, making it cost-effective for developers and users.
- Smart Contracts: Solana supports smart contracts, allowing developers to build decentralized applications with ease.
- Cross-Chain Interoperability: Solana is working on cross-chain interoperability solutions to enable seamless communication between different blockchains.
3. Binance Smart Chain vs Solana: Key Differences
3.1 Scalability
Binance Smart Chain offers high scalability with its dual-token mechanism, capable of handling up to 1,000 transactions per second during peak times. Solana, on the other hand, boasts an even higher throughput of 50,000 transactions per second. This makes Solana the clear winner in terms of scalability.
3.2 Transaction Fees
Both Binance Smart Chain and Solana offer low transaction fees compared to Ethereum. However, Solana's fees are significantly lower, making it a more cost-effective option for developers and users. In this aspect, Solana takes the lead.
3.3 Consensus Mechanism
Binance Smart Chain utilizes a Proof of Staked Authority (PoSA) consensus mechanism, while Solana employs the unique Proof of History (PoH) mechanism. Both mechanisms are designed to enhance scalability and efficiency. However, Solana's PoH mechanism is considered more innovative and efficient, giving it an edge in this category.
3.4 Cross-Chain Interoperability
Binance Smart Chain has already achieved cross-chain compatibility with Ethereum, allowing for seamless asset and data transfer between the two platforms. Solana is also working on cross-chain interoperability solutions but is still in the development phase. As of now, Binance Smart Chain has a slight advantage in this area.
4. Conclusion
In conclusion, both Binance Smart Chain and Solana are powerful blockchain platforms with unique features and capabilities. While Solana takes the lead in terms of scalability and transaction fees, Binance Smart Chain has an edge in cross-chain interoperability. Ultimately, the choice between the two platforms depends on the specific needs and preferences of developers and users. As blockchain technology continues to evolve, both Binance Smart Chain and Solana are poised to play significant roles in shaping the future of decentralized applications and smart contracts.
